ABRAHAM LINCOLN BRIDGE

This suspension bridge opened in December, 2015, but today was our first time to drive over it. It is amazingly slight & artistically beautiful for the strength it must have. The bridge is over the Ohio River connecting Louisville, KY and Indiana on I-65. To either side you can see two other bridges (this suspension bridge replaced one of them and the second connects other state highways). The older bridges’ heftier metal construction gives an appearance of sure strength; however, the technology of this new bridge is simply that the highway is held up by cables. It doesn’t look as strong but outdoes its predecessor by far. Quite an engineering accomplishment!
